It is essential to keep your coffee maker regularly clean and descaled, whether you're using a dual-use model or one-serve models. This will eliminate the mineral residue that can build within your brewer, which could cause it to stop functioning or even taste bad. Most manufacturers recommend descaling every one to three months, and the majority have instructions for how to do this in their manuals of instruction.
